Selecting a Reputable Installation Company

Choosing a reputable flag pole installation company near you is crucial to ensure that your flag pole is installed correctly, safely, and efficiently. A reliable installation company will have a team of experienced professionals, necessary equipment, and high-quality materials to complete the project on time.

  • Experience: Look for a company with years of experience in flag pole installation. Check their portfolio and customer reviews to ensure they have installed similar projects with success.
  • Qualifications: Check if the company has the necessary licenses and certifications to operate in your area. Verify their qualifications with local authorities.
  • Insurance: Make sure the company has liability insurance to protect you and their workers in case of accidents or property damage.
  • Warranty: A reputable company should offer a warranty on their work and products. Check the duration and coverage of the warranty.
  • References: Ask for references from previous customers and contact them to get an idea of the company’s work quality and customer service.

A reputable installation company will also have a physical address, a business license, and necessary insurance to protect you and their workers.

Types of Installation Companies: Local vs. National

When choosing a flag pole installation company near you, you may come across local and national installation companies. Each type of company has its pros and cons, and it’s essential to consider these factors before making a decision.

  • Local Companies: Local companies are owned and operated by individuals or small businesses in your area. They may have a strong sense of community and are often more responsive to local needs. However, their resources may be limited, and they might not have access to the latest technology and equipment.
  • National Companies: National companies are larger and more widespread, operating in multiple locations across the country. They often have more resources, including advanced technology and equipment, and may offer a wider range of services. However, they may be more expensive, and their customer service may be less personalized.

Aluminum Flag Poles

Aluminum flag poles are a popular choice due to their lightweight, corrosion-resistant, and durable nature. They are made from high-quality aluminum alloys that can withstand harsh weather conditions, including extreme temperatures, high winds, and precipitation. Aluminum flag poles are also easy to install and require minimal maintenance. However, they can be prone to scratches and dents, which can affect their appearance.

Fiberglass Flag Poles

Fiberglass flag poles are made from a combination of glass and resin, making them incredibly durable and resistant to corrosion. They are also lightweight and easy to install, making them an excellent choice for areas with high wind speeds or saltwater environments. Fiberglass flag poles are available in various colors and can be customized to fit specific design requirements.

Wooden Flag Poles

Wooden flag poles are a classic choice, providing a natural and rustic appearance. They are available in various types of wood, including cedar, pine, and cypress, each with its unique characteristics and benefits. Wooden flag poles are easy to install and require minimal maintenance, but they are prone to weathering and damage from insects and rodents.

Some examples of wooden flag poles include:

  • Cedar flag poles: These are made from Western red cedar, providing excellent durability and resistance to rot and insects.
  • Pine flag poles: These are made from Southern yellow pine, offering a more rustic appearance and affordable price.

Importance of Proper Ladder Usage

Using a ladder requires a mix of skill, caution, and common sense. When using a ladder to install a flag pole, ensure it’s positioned on firm, level ground, away from any obstacles or slip hazards. Always maintain three points of contact – two hands and one foot, or two feet and one hand – while climbing or working on the ladder. Stepping on the top rung should be a last resort. If you’re unsure about ladder safety or height, consider hiring a professional for the installation.

Essential Safety Equipment and Materials

When working on installing a flag pole, it’s essential to have the right safety equipment and materials to prevent accidents:

  • Hard Hat or Safety Helmet: Protects your head from falls or flying debris. Ensure it fits properly, with the chin strap securely fastened.
  • Harness and Rope System: A fall restraint or fall arrest system prevents you from falling to the ground in case of a slip or loss of balance.
  • Non-Slip Ladder Boots or Socks: Provide traction and prevent slipping on rungs.
  • Safety glasses and gloves: Shield your eyes from debris and protect your hands from cuts and abrasions.
  • First aid kit: In case of minor accidents, a first aid kit will come in handy.
